The single reached no. 34 in UK and US. After the release, in an interview Elton said: ' It's about the silliness of rock 'n' roll stars, and the video film was supposed to show just how stupid rock 'n' roll can be. It's the grotesque side of rock 'n' roll. And it's turned out to be one of the most sincere songs we've ever written'.
Song details
  • Co-Production: Elton John and Clive Franks
  • Composition: Bernie Taupin and Elton John
  • Vocals: Elton John
  • Release Date: 21 March 1978
It's a bonus track on the 1998 Mercury reissue.
